Role and Responsibilities
As a Delivery Associate, you will play a critical role in USPS's commitment to dependable and secure mail and package delivery. You will be responsible for ensuring that all deliveries are made efficiently, accurately, and on time.
- Sort and prepare mail and packages for daily delivery routes
- Operate a USPS vehicle or walk to deliver mail along assigned routes
- Collect outgoing mail from collection boxes and customer mailboxes
- Ensure accurate and safe delivery of packages, including those requiring signatures
- Maintain delivery logs and report any delivery issues promptly
- Provide courteous and professional service to all USPS customers
- Follow established safety procedures and USPS operational standards
